[Linux操作系统]探秘Docker安全,实战中的最佳实践解析|docker的安全性,Docker安全最佳实践
本文深入探讨了Linux操作系统下的Docker安全,详细解析了实战中的Docker安全最佳实践。通过了解docker的安全性,为读者提供了在运用Docker过程中保障系统安全的宝贵经验。
本文目录导读:
随着云计算和容器技术的飞速发展,Docker作为一款轻量级、可移植的容器化解决方案,已经在众多企业和开发者中广泛应用,在享受Docker带来的便捷的同时,安全问题也日益凸显,本文将介绍Docker安全最佳实践,帮助大家构建更安全的容器环境。
Docker安全概述
Docker安全主要包括以下几个方面:
1、容器隔离:确保容器之间互不影响,防止恶意攻击。
2、容器逃逸:防止容器内的进程逃逸到宿主机,导致系统安全问题。
3、镜像安全:确保镜像来源可靠,避免恶意软件植入。
4、数据安全:保护容器内的数据不被非法访问和篡改。
以下将从这几个方面展开,介绍Docker安全最佳实践。
Docker安全最佳实践
1、容器隔离
(1)使用最新版本的Docker:确保容器引擎的安全性,及时修复已知漏洞。
(2)最小化权限原则:为容器分配最小权限,避免使用root用户。
(3)利用cgroups限制资源:合理分配容器资源,防止恶意消耗宿主机资源。
2、容器逃逸
(1)禁用privileged模式:该模式会赋予容器很高的权限,容易导致容器逃逸。
(2)限制容器访问宿主机设备:避免容器访问宿主机的敏感设备,如磁盘、网络设备等。
(3)定期检查系统日志:关注容器运行过程中的异常行为,及时发现并处理安全问题。
3、镜像安全
(1)使用官方镜像:尽可能使用官方认证的镜像,降低安全风险。
(2)镜像签名:使用镜像签名机制,确保镜像来源可靠。
(3)定期更新镜像:关注官方镜像的更新,及时修复安全漏洞。
4、数据安全
(1)数据卷加密:对容器数据卷进行加密,防止数据泄露。
(2)数据备份:定期备份容器数据,以防万一。
(3)设置合理的文件权限:避免容器内的敏感文件被非法访问。
以下是50个中文相关关键词:
Docker, 安全, 最佳实践, 容器隔离, 容器逃逸, 镜像安全, 数据安全, 权限控制, 资源限制, 日志检查, 官方镜像, 镜像签名, 数据卷加密, 数据备份
以下为具体关键词:
Docker安全, 容器安全, 安全策略, 隔离机制, 逃逸攻击, 镜像来源, 数据保护, 权限管理, 资源分配, 系统日志, 官方认证, 签名验证, 加密技术, 数据备份策略, 安全漏洞, 漏洞修复, 云计算, 容器化, 轻量级, 可移植, 恶意攻击, 宿主机, 恶意软件, 数据泄露, 文件权限, 网络安全, 数据备份, 安全审计, 安全合规, 安全防护, 安全加固, 安全监控, 安全事件, 安全预警, 安全配置, 安全扫描, 安全策略制定, 安全风险评估, 安全培训, 安全意识, 安全投入, 安全运维, 安全开发, 安全测试, 安全认证, 安全标准, 安全框架。
就是关于Docker安全最佳实践的介绍,希望对大家有所帮助,在实际应用中,我们要时刻关注安全问题,不断完善和优化容器环境,确保业务的安全稳定运行。